A way to uninstall Smart Radio Player v.3.1 from your PC

This page contains thorough information on how to uninstall Smart Radio Player v.3.1 for Windows. It is made by Ivan BUBLOZ. You can find out more on Ivan BUBLOZ or check for application updates here. The program is often found in the C:\Program Files\Smart Radio Player directory (same installation drive as Windows). You can remove Smart Radio Player v.3.1 by clicking on the Start menu of Windows and pasting the command line C:\Program Files\Smart Radio Player\unins000.exe. Keep in mind that you might receive a notification for admin rights. Smart Radio Player v.3.1's main file takes around 544.00 KB (557056 bytes) and is named Smart Radio Player.exe.

The following executables are contained in Smart Radio Player v.3.1. They take 1.20 MB (1255886 bytes) on disk.

  • Smart Radio Player.exe (544.00 KB)
  • unins000.exe (682.45 KB)


The information on this page is only about version 3.1 of Smart Radio Player v.3.1.
